#communitycalendarheading p a,
#programsheading p a,
#wereyourteamheading p a,
#patientresourcestext p a,
#whatsnewtext p a,
#whatsnewheading p a,
#programstext p a,
#communitycalendartext p a,
#patientresourcesheading p a,
#wereyourteamtext p a  {
   display: inline;
}

#bottomgreynavbar,
#editbutton,
#durhamaddress,
#walkertonaddress,
#mildmayaddress  {
   z-index: 7;
}

#i0continuebutton a.nmh,
#i0continuebutton a:hover  {
   background-position: -228px 0%;
}

#i2continuebutton a:hover,
#i2continuebutton a.nmh  {
   background-position: -158px 0%;
}

#i3continuebutton a:hover,
#i3continuebutton a.nmh  {
   background-position: -148px 0%;
}

#i1continuebutton a:hover,
#i1continuebutton a.nmh  {
   background-position: -211px 0%;
}

#morebutton a.nmh,
#morebutton a:hover  {
   background-position: -93px 0%;
}

#paisleyaddress,
#lowermenumenu  {
   z-index: 8;
}

#programsapplepictureconte  {
   position: absolute;
   left: 503px;
   top: 680px;
   z-index: 6;
   width: 417px;
   height: 148px;
}

#whatsnewapplepictureconte  {
   position: absolute;
   left: 36px;
   top: 680px;
   z-index: 7;
   width: 417px;
   height: 148px;
}

#communitycalendarheading  {
   position: absolute;
   left: 506px;
   top: 1307px;
   z-index: 5;
   width: 339px;
}

#patientresourcesheading  {
   position: absolute;
   left: 38px;
   top: 1307px;
   z-index: 6;
   width: 359px;
}

#communitycalendartext  {
   position: absolute;
   left: 506px;
   top: 1362px;
   z-index: 5;
   width: 414px;
}

#prapplepicturecontent  {
   position: absolute;
   left: 36px;
   top: 1139px;
   z-index: 6;
   width: 417px;
   height: 148px;
}

#patientresourcestext  {
   position: absolute;
   left: 39px;
   top: 1362px;
   z-index: 6;
   width: 414px;
}

#grouppicturecontent  {
   position: absolute;
   left: 613px;
   top: 258px;
   z-index: 4;
   width: 313px;
   height: 378px;
}

#wereyourteamheading  {
   position: absolute;
   left: 38px;
   top: 277px;
   z-index: 4;
   width: 237px;
}

#i0continuebutton a  {
   background-image: url(sg_home_media/d0continuebutton.gif);
   background-repeat: no-repeat;
   display: block;
   height: 15px;
   width: 228px;
   font-size: 15px;
   line-height: 15px;
}

#i3continuebutton a  {
   background-image: url(sg_home_media/d3continuebutton.gif);
   background-repeat: no-repeat;
   display: block;
   height: 13px;
   width: 148px;
   font-size: 13px;
   line-height: 13px;
}

#i2continuebutton a  {
   background-image: url(sg_home_media/d2continuebutton.gif);
   background-repeat: no-repeat;
   display: block;
   height: 15px;
   width: 158px;
   font-size: 15px;
   line-height: 15px;
}

#i1continuebutton a  {
   background-image: url(sg_home_media/d1continuebutton.gif);
   background-repeat: no-repeat;
   display: block;
   height: 13px;
   width: 211px;
   font-size: 13px;
   line-height: 13px;
}

#i3continuebutton  {
   position: absolute;
   left: 305px;
   top: 1081px;
   z-index: 7;
   width: 148px;
   height: 13px;
}

#i1continuebutton  {
   position: absolute;
   left: 242px;
   top: 1540px;
   z-index: 6;
   width: 211px;
   height: 13px;
}

#wereyourteamtext  {
   position: absolute;
   left: 39px;
   top: 334px;
   z-index: 4;
   width: 562px;
}

#i0continuebutton  {
   position: absolute;
   left: 693px;
   top: 1540px;
   z-index: 5;
   width: 228px;
   height: 15px;
}

#i2continuebutton  {
   position: absolute;
   left: 762px;
   top: 1081px;
   z-index: 6;
   width: 158px;
   height: 15px;
}

#i2backgroundbox  {
   position: absolute;
   left: 482px;
   top: 664px;
   z-index: 5;
   width: 468px;
   height: 459px;
   background-image: url(sg_home_media/d2backgroundbox.jpg);
   background-repeat: no-repeat;
}

#i4backgroundbox  {
   position: absolute;
   left: 15px;
   top: 248px;
   z-index: 3;
   width: 934px;
   height: 415px;
   background-image: url(sg_home_media/d4backgroundbox.png);
   background-repeat: no-repeat;
}

#page_bkg,
#page  {
   height: 1793px;
}

#programsheading  {
   position: absolute;
   left: 506px;
   top: 848px;
   z-index: 6;
   width: 237px;
}

#whatsnewheading  {
   position: absolute;
   left: 38px;
   top: 848px;
   z-index: 7;
   width: 237px;
}

#homepagecolumn  {
   min-height: 73px;
   width: 957px;
   margin-left: 0px;
   margin-right: 0px;
   margin-top: 1578px;
   margin-bottom: 0px;
}

#verticalliines  {
   z-index: 10;
}

#chesleyaddress  {
   z-index: 9;
}

#applepicture  {
   position: absolute;
   left: 503px;
   top: 1139px;
   z-index: 5;
   width: 417px;
   height: 148px;
   background-image: url(sg_home_media/applepicture.jpg);
   background-repeat: no-repeat;
}

#programstext  {
   position: absolute;
   left: 506px;
   top: 903px;
   z-index: 6;
   width: 414px;
}

#whatsnewtext  {
   position: absolute;
   left: 39px;
   top: 903px;
   z-index: 7;
   width: 414px;
}

#morebutton a  {
   background-image: url(sg_home_media/morebutton.gif);
   background-repeat: no-repeat;
   display: block;
   height: 13px;
   width: 93px;
   font-size: 13px;
   line-height: 13px;
}

#i4fadedline  {
   position: absolute;
   left: 18px;
   top: 316px;
   z-index: 4;
   width: 579px;
   height: 2px;
   background-image: url(sg_home_media/d4fadedline.png);
   background-repeat: no-repeat;
}

#arrowcopy3  {
   position: absolute;
   left: 15px;
   top: 1124px;
   z-index: 5;
   width: 468px;
   height: 529px;
   background-image: url(sg_home_media/arrowcopy3.png);
   background-repeat: no-repeat;
}

#arrowcopy2  {
   position: absolute;
   left: 746px;
   top: 1080px;
   z-index: 6;
   width: 12px;
   height: 13px;
   background-image: url(sg_home_media/arrowcopy2.gif);
   background-repeat: no-repeat;
}

#morebutton  {
   position: absolute;
   left: 508px;
   top: 621px;
   z-index: 4;
   width: 93px;
   height: 13px;
}

#ridefooter  {
   margin-top: 144px;
}

#arrowcopy4  {
   position: absolute;
   left: 482px;
   top: 1123px;
   z-index: 4;
   width: 468px;
   height: 494px;
   background-image: url(sg_home_media/arrowcopy4.png);
   background-repeat: no-repeat;
}

#arrowcopy  {
   position: absolute;
   left: 15px;
   top: 664px;
   z-index: 6;
   width: 468px;
   height: 459px;
   background-image: url(sg_home_media/arrowcopy.png);
   background-repeat: no-repeat;
}

#swoosh  {
   z-index: 6;
}

#arrow  {
   position: absolute;
   left: 492px;
   top: 620px;
   z-index: 4;
   width: 12px;
   height: 13px;
   background-image: url(sg_home_media/arrowcopy2.gif);
   background-repeat: no-repeat;
}


